Hit The 10,000 Mark
Chances are, your smartphone has a health app that measures your step count without you even noticing. If, however, you are a luddite, then go and get yourself a pedometer, and start trying to hit that big 10,000 mark every day. Eventually, doing outdoor activities like walking will become the norm. Losing calories and changing your attitude; it’s a double win.
Change Up Your Commute
If you work from home, then there is very little you can do. If, however, you are required to head to an office, then why not swap your car for a bicycle. Sure, you may live too far away for that to be plausible, or the route may just be motorways, but most of the time you are kidding yourself. It could just be that you get off your train three stops early and cycle the rest of the way. Whatever it takes, your commute will become more enjoyable and healthier.

Veggie Breakfast
Think about your breakfast routine. Toast and marmite. Zero goodness. Cereal. High in sugar. Sausages and bacon. Lots of fat. What you need to do is start adding fruit to your breakfast. Fruits with muesli and natural yoghurt. Eggs, tomato, and avocado. Make some breakfast frittatas. Get into the habit of creating a healthy smoothie with kale. Whatever takes your taste buds fancy.

Boost Your Flexibility
This could be done through pilates or yoga or even pole-dancing classes. It doesn’t matter the means in which you boost your flexibility, it just matters that you do. It could even be that you just stretch out every morning, with a goal in mind, such as being able to touch your toes. Once you have mastered that, try and work towards a chest on legs scenario.
